    What is Eco Mode in Cars?

    Eco mode is a popular feature found in many modern cars that aims to optimize fuel consumption and promote eco-friendly driving practices. When activated, this mode adjusts the engine’s performance and reduces throttle response to improve fuel efficiency. By controlling various aspects of the vehicle’s operation, eco mode helps drivers save fuel and reduce their carbon footprint.

    When eco mode is engaged, it automatically adjusts the throttle and transmission behavior to maximize fuel economy. This means that the engine responds less aggressively to acceleration inputs, resulting in a smoother and more gradual increase in speed. The reduced throttle response helps to limit fuel consumption by minimizing the amount of fuel injected into the engine during acceleration.

    In addition to throttle control, eco mode includes other operational changes aimed at saving energy. For example, it may lower shift points to keep the engine running at lower RPMs, use the air conditioning system more efficiently, and reduce the brightness of interior and exterior lights. These adjustments contribute to overall fuel savings and promote sustainable driving practices.

    By utilizing eco mode, drivers can achieve better fuel economy without compromising the functionality and performance of their vehicles. However, it’s important to note that the extent of fuel savings may vary depending on the specific car model and driving conditions. Factors such as road terrain, traffic congestion, and individual driving habits can influence the effectiveness of eco mode in reducing fuel consumption.

    The Working Principle of Eco Mode

    The working principle behind eco mode is to optimize energy usage by prioritizing fuel efficiency. When the eco mode is engaged, it adjusts various parameters of the vehicle’s operation to achieve this goal. Here are some key aspects of the working principle of eco mode:

    • Throttle Response: Eco mode reduces the throttle response, resulting in a gradual and controlled acceleration. This prevents excessive fuel consumption during quick acceleration bursts.
    • Transmission Behavior: The mode also optimizes transmission behavior by adjusting shift points and gear ratios. This helps keep the engine operating at lower RPMs, where it is more fuel-efficient.
    • Air Conditioning Optimization: Eco mode may adjust the air conditioning system to reduce energy consumption. For example, it may limit the system’s power output or adjust the temperature settings for optimal efficiency.
    • Lighting Adjustments: To further save energy, eco mode may reduce the brightness of interior and exterior lights. This helps minimize the electrical load on the vehicle’s battery.

    By combining these adjustments, eco mode ensures that the vehicle operates in a manner that maximizes fuel efficiency while maintaining a comfortable driving experience.

    Tips for Fuel-Efficient Driving

    Adopting fuel-efficient driving techniques not only helps reduce fuel consumption but also contributes to a more sustainable and environmentally friendly approach to driving. By incorporating these techniques into your daily driving habits, you can play your part in reducing carbon dioxide emissions and promoting a greener future.

    Gentle Acceleration

    Accelerate gently, taking around 5 seconds to reach 20 kilometers per hour. This practice is particularly effective in city driving, where abrupt acceleration consumes more fuel. By gradually increasing your speed, you can optimize fuel usage and save money at the pump.

    Maintain a Steady Speed

    Avoid constant speed adjustments by maintaining a steady speed whenever possible. Unnecessary changes in speed result in increased fuel consumption. By focusing on maintaining a consistent pace, you can reduce fuel usage and improve overall fuel efficiency.

    Anticipate Traffic

    Anticipating traffic and keeping a safe distance from the vehicle ahead can help you maintain a consistent speed and avoid unnecessary acceleration and deceleration. By being mindful of the road ahead and making adjustments in advance, you can optimize fuel usage and minimize the impact of stop-and-go traffic.

    Avoid High Speeds

    Driving at high speeds significantly reduces fuel efficiency. As vehicles become less fuel-efficient above certain speeds, it’s advisable to avoid excessive speeds whenever possible. By adhering to speed limits and maintaining a moderate pace, you can achieve better fuel economy and reduce fuel consumption.

    Coast to Decelerate

    Instead of using your brakes to decelerate, try coasting by taking your foot off the accelerator. This allows the vehicle’s momentum to slow it down naturally, reducing the reliance on fuel and minimizing brake wear. Coasting to decelerate is particularly effective when approaching traffic lights or stop signs.

    By following these fuel-efficient driving techniques, you can make a tangible difference in reducing fuel consumption and lowering your carbon footprint. Not only will you save money on fuel costs, but you will also contribute to a more sustainable future for Canada and the planet as a whole.

    Additional Ways to Use Less Fuel

    When it comes to reducing fuel consumption and costs, there are several additional strategies you can employ:

    Avoid Idling

    Idling your vehicle for more than 60 seconds is not only wasteful but also consumes unnecessary fuel. To conserve fuel, it’s best to turn off the engine when parked or waiting for extended periods of time.

    Measure Tire Pressure

    Regularly measuring and maintaining optimal tire pressure can significantly improve fuel efficiency. Underinflated tires can increase rolling resistance, causing the engine to work harder and consume more fuel. Using a tire pressure gauge, keep your tires properly inflated according to the manufacturer’s recommendations.

    Use Manual Transmission Properly

    If your vehicle has a manual transmission, using it properly can help maximize fuel efficiency. Shift gears at the right time to ensure the engine operates within the optimal RPM range. This can help minimize fuel consumption and improve overall fuel economy.

    Avoid Carrying Unnecessary Weight

    Carrying unnecessary weight in your vehicle can have a negative impact on fuel consumption. Empty out your trunk and remove any items that you don’t need for your journey. By reducing the weight your vehicle carries, you can increase fuel efficiency and save on fuel costs.

    Remove Roof/Bicycle Racks

    When not in use, remove any roof or bicycle racks from your vehicle. These accessories create additional drag, which can decrease fuel efficiency. By removing them when not needed, you can streamline your vehicle’s aerodynamics and improve fuel economy.

    Use Air Conditioning Sparingly

    While air conditioning provides comfort during hot weather, it also increases fuel consumption. To conserve fuel, use your air conditioning sparingly. Opt for other methods of cooling, such as opening windows or using the vehicle’s ventilation system, whenever possible.

    Utilize a Fuel Consumption Display

    Many modern vehicles are equipped with a fuel consumption display that provides real-time feedback on your driving habits. Utilize this feature to monitor and adjust your driving style for better fuel efficiency. Take note of how different driving techniques and conditions affect your fuel consumption.

    Track Fuel Consumption

    Keeping track of your fuel consumption over time is essential for monitoring the effectiveness of your fuel-saving techniques. This information can help identify areas for improvement and enable you to make adjustments to further reduce fuel consumption. Consider maintaining a log or using smartphone apps that track and analyze fuel consumption data.

    By implementing these additional strategies, you can further optimize your fuel efficiency and reduce fuel consumption, ultimately saving money and minimizing your environmental impact.

    Planning Ahead for Fuel Efficiency

    Planning ahead is a crucial step in maximizing fuel efficiency and reducing your carbon footprint. By taking a few simple steps, you can make every trip more fuel-efficient and environmentally friendly. Let’s explore some practical tips for planning ahead to optimize your fuel efficiency:

    1. Map out your route: Before starting your journey, take the time to map out your route, especially for long trips. Using a GPS or mapping app, you can identify the most efficient path that minimizes both distance and potential traffic congestion. This helps you avoid unnecessary detours and saves fuel.
    2. Listen to traffic reports: Stay informed about current traffic conditions by listening to traffic reports on the radio or using a traffic app. By avoiding high-traffic areas, you can reduce idle time and maintain a more consistent speed, ultimately enhancing fuel efficiency.
    3. Choose four-lane highways: Whenever possible, opt for four-lane highways for your journey. These highways typically have fewer stoplights, smoother traffic flow, and higher speed limits, allowing you to maintain a steady speed and save fuel.
    4. Combine trips: Whenever feasible, try to combine multiple errands or tasks into a single trip. By reducing the number of separate trips, you can minimize mileage and frequency of driving, leading to significant fuel savings over time.
    5. Drive less: Ultimately, one of the most effective ways to achieve fuel efficiency is to drive less whenever possible. Consider alternative modes of transportation such as walking, biking, or using public transit for shorter trips. Additionally, carpooling with colleagues or friends can help reduce individual fuel usage and promote a greener commute.

    By incorporating these planning strategies into your everyday life, you can make a positive impact on fuel efficiency and contribute to a more sustainable future.
